Ecosyste.ms: OpenCollective
An open API service for software projects hosted on Open Collective.
github.com/llvm/circt
Circuit IR Compilers and Tools
https://github.com/llvm/circt
Support `scf.if` Op Lowering to Calyx
jiahanxie353 opened this pull request over 1 year ago
jiahanxie353 opened this pull request over 1 year ago
[Seq] Add optional power-on value to `compreg` ops
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Comb] Disallow canonicalization across MLIR blocks
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L] FirRegLowering mux-to-if conversion check could be more performant
mikeurbach opened this issue over 1 year ago
mikeurbach opened this issue over 1 year ago
[Ibis] Add handshake to DC conversion
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Fix issues in Tunneling and PortRef lowering
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Fix clean selfdrivers in case of external reads
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
test: Add some defensive FileCheck options.
dtzSiFive opened this pull request over 1 year ago
dtzSiFive opened this pull request over 1 year ago
[Pipeline] Remove internal clock, reset,stall signals.
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Allow tunneling from `hw.module`s
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Print offending port name and use count on containers-to-hw error
blakep-msft opened this pull request over 1 year ago
blakep-msft opened this pull request over 1 year ago
[Ibis] Add Ibis CF to Handshake conversion
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[HW] Align instance_like_impl verification with `getReferencedModule`
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[NFC][ExportVerilog] Move location emission functions to class
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Allow multiple return values for `ibis.method`
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[NFC][Handshake] Adjust handshake interface defs and file locs
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Handshake] Allow handshake ops to be used outside of a `handshake.func`
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Rename `ibis.block` -> `ibis.sblock`
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[HW] Support parametric UnpackedArrayType in hw-specialize
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Pipeline] Fix issue in ExplicitRegs
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Add ibis reblock p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Transforms] Move generally applicable passes to transforms
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[firtool] Run canonicalizer before LowerTypes
uenoku opened this pull request over 1 year ago
uenoku opened this pull request over 1 year ago
[Ibis] Add `--ibis-argify-blocks` p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Seq] Add shiftreg op
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[SV] Fix --hw-eliminate-inout-ports
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
Enable default builders for pipeline.LatencyOp
blakep-msft opened this pull request over 1 year ago
blakep-msft opened this pull request over 1 year ago
[HW] Use properties to store inherent attributes in HW ops.
dtzSiFive opened this pull request over 1 year ago
dtzSiFive opened this pull request over 1 year ago
[Ibis] Add ibis.schedule op
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Pipeline] valid -> enable
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[sifive-1.5] Bump workflows from ubuntu-18.04 to 20.04
jackkoenig opened this pull request over 1 year ago
jackkoenig opened this pull request over 1 year ago
[NFC] Don't directly poke location attributes from FlattenIO.cpp
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[Calyx] Add calyx.undef
rachitnigam opened this pull request over 1 year ago
rachitnigam opened this pull request over 1 year ago
[HW] HWModules don't implement FunctionOpInterface
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[Pipeline] Propagate names in `-pipeline-explicit-regs`
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[SV] Add suffix options to --hw-eliminate-inout-ports
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Ibis] Add container-to-HW lowering p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[NFC] Add a Module Signature Converter which operates on HWModuleLike not FunctionOpInterface
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[NFC] Make FIRRTL modules not implement hwmodulelike
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[Transform] Initialize a new pass - GenStateStruct pass in Transform
cepheus69 opened this pull request over 1 year ago
cepheus69 opened this pull request over 1 year ago
[SV] Initialize a new pass - SVTriggerAttrGen pass in SV Transform
cepheus69 opened this pull request over 1 year ago
cepheus69 opened this pull request over 1 year ago
[HW/Support] Introduce InstanceGraph interface
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Seq] Add FirRom op
vowstar opened this pull request over 1 year ago
vowstar opened this pull request over 1 year ago
Abstract out PortList from HWModuleLike
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
New Module Parse Style
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[NFC] factor out port printing
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
ExportVerilog emits ports preserving their order.
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
Passes
MuhammadTalha-10 opened this issue over 1 year ago
MuhammadTalha-10 opened this issue over 1 year ago
[NFC] Use ModuleType to compute many properties
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[DC] `dc.value` should only take one type
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[NFC] change ModulePortInfo to store in a single array and get rid of redundant APIs. This is preparation for not splitting inputs and outputs.
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[DC] Add cast to/from ESI ops
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[NFC] Move functions from HWMutableModuleLike to HWModuleLike
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[Docs] Update dialects.dot for LoopSchedule
andrewb1999 opened this pull request over 1 year ago
andrewb1999 opened this pull request over 1 year ago
[Seq] Add FIFO lowering
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Verif] Add `format_verilog_string, print` operations
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L][LowerTypes] Consistently use 64bit for fieldID attr.
dtzSiFive opened this pull request over 1 year ago
dtzSiFive opened this pull request over 1 year ago
[Pipeline] Allow explicitly named registers and passthroughs
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[SCFToCalyx] Use sequential memories
andrewb1999 opened this pull request over 1 year ago
andrewb1999 opened this pull request over 1 year ago
[FIRRTL][LowerToHW] Zero-width signals with inner symbol are silently deleted, breaking users
dtzSiFive opened this issue over 1 year ago
dtzSiFive opened this issue over 1 year ago
[HW] Add `hw.triggered` op
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Pipeline] Add missing name arg to builder
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[PipelineToHW] Don't CE pipeline regs in non-stallable pipelines
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L][InferResets] Should report nicely when a synchronous reset is annotated with FullAsyncResetAnnotation
rwy7 opened this issue over 1 year ago
rwy7 opened this issue over 1 year ago
[ExportVerilog] Missing `hw.struct_explode` support?
7FM opened this issue over 1 year ago
7FM opened this issue over 1 year ago
[Calyx] Add sequential memories
andrewb1999 opened this pull request over 1 year ago
andrewb1999 opened this pull request over 1 year ago
[Seq] Unify `seq`-dialect memory representations
mortbopet opened this issue over 1 year ago
mortbopet opened this issue over 1 year ago
[FIRRTL][InferWidths] Back-prop for mux selector operand; different than subaccess
dtzSiFive opened this issue over 1 year ago
dtzSiFive opened this issue over 1 year ago
[HW/SV] Add `hw.inout` elimination p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[Pipeline] Add verifiers and fix register materialization p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L] Add string concatenation operation
youngar opened this pull request over 1 year ago
youngar opened this pull request over 1 year ago
[Calyx] Add Static Groups and Control
andrewb1999 opened this pull request over 1 year ago
andrewb1999 opened this pull request over 1 year ago
[Pipeline] Add "ext" inputs to pipelines
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[DCToHW] Add DCToHW conversion pass
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
Update GettingStarted.md
flippers2652 opened this pull request over 1 year ago
flippers2652 opened this pull request over 1 year ago
circt-opt round-trip support (+add to CI?)
dtzSiFive opened this issue over 1 year ago
dtzSiFive opened this issue over 1 year ago
Add LTL and Verif dialects
fabianschuiki opened this pull request over 1 year ago
fabianschuiki opened this pull request over 1 year ago
[FIRRTL] Introduce notation of discardable annotation
uenoku opened this pull request over 1 year ago
uenoku opened this pull request over 1 year ago
[HandshakeToDC] Add conversion
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[DC] Add merge operation
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[DC] Address canonicalizer review comments
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L] CAPI Additions
eigenform opened this pull request over 1 year ago
eigenform opened this pull request over 1 year ago
[DC] Add fork/sink materialization passes
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L] Bump minimum to 2.0.0, remove partial connect
seldridge opened this pull request over 1 year ago
seldridge opened this pull request over 1 year ago
[Dedup] Vector of bundles, with different field names should dedup
prithayan opened this issue over 1 year ago
prithayan opened this issue over 1 year ago
Verilog frontend integration
fabianschuiki opened this pull request over 1 year ago
fabianschuiki opened this pull request over 1 year ago
[Handshake] Remove handshake.select
mortbopet opened this pull request over 1 year ago
mortbopet opened this pull request over 1 year ago
[FIRRTL] Support rwprobe that targets a port.
dtzSiFive opened this issue over 1 year ago
dtzSiFive opened this issue over 1 year ago
[FIRRTL] lower plusargs to initial block
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[FIRRTL] Lower complex enum to hw
darthscsi opened this pull request over 1 year ago
darthscsi opened this pull request over 1 year ago
[FIRRTL] Enum tag extraction op
darthscsi opened this pull request almost 2 years ago
darthscsi opened this pull request almost 2 years ago
[LoopSchedule] Move PipelineWhile and related ops from Pipeline to LoopSchedule
andrewb1999 opened this pull request almost 2 years ago
andrewb1999 opened this pull request almost 2 years ago
[FIRRTL] InferResets Not Duplicating Modules When Necessary
jackkoenig opened this issue almost 2 years ago
jackkoenig opened this issue almost 2 years ago
How to avoid Unhandled annotation in Chisel-CIRCT
LandonWong opened this issue almost 2 years ago
LandonWong opened this issue almost 2 years ago
[FIRRTL] Merge constants in concatinations and drop double inversion
darthscsi opened this pull request almost 2 years ago
darthscsi opened this pull request almost 2 years ago
[FIRRTL] Narrow And, Or, and Xor
darthscsi opened this pull request almost 2 years ago
darthscsi opened this pull request almost 2 years ago
[FIRRTL] prune duplicate conditions from mux trees
darthscsi opened this pull request almost 2 years ago
darthscsi opened this pull request almost 2 years ago
[FIRRLT] Narrow adds
darthscsi opened this pull request almost 2 years ago
darthscsi opened this pull request almost 2 years ago
[SV] Added DPI import and call ops
nandor opened this pull request almost 2 years ago
nandor opened this pull request almost 2 years ago
[Arc] A proposal about Arc simulation
cepheus69 opened this issue almost 2 years ago
cepheus69 opened this issue almost 2 years ago